Download this file

Costing.ucls    154 lines (154 with data), 9.3 kB

<?xml version="1.0" encoding="UTF-8"?>
<class-diagram version="1.1.3" icons="true" always-add-relationships="false" generalizations="true" realizations="true" 
  associations="true" dependencies="false" nesting-relationships="true">  
  <class id="1" language="java" name="net.timbusproject.dpes.analyse.Costing" project="dpesWebapp" 
    file="/dpesWebapp/src/main/java/net/timbusproject/dpes/analyse/Costing.java" binary="false" corner="BOTTOM_RIGHT">    
    <position height="-1" width="-1" x="91" y="-107"/>    
    <display autosize="true" stereotype="true" package="true" initial-value="false" signature="true" accessors="true" 
      visibility="true">      
      <attributes public="true" package="true" protected="true" private="true" static="true"/>      
      <operations public="true" package="true" protected="true" private="true" static="true"/>    
    </display>  
  </class>  
  <class id="2" language="java" name="net.timbusproject.dpes.data.BusinessProcess" project="dpesWebapp" 
    file="/dpesWebapp/src/main/java/net/timbusproject/dpes/data/BusinessProcess.java" binary="false" 
    corner="BOTTOM_RIGHT">    
    <position height="730" width="273" x="481" y="-714"/>    
    <display autosize="false" stereotype="true" package="true" initial-value="false" signature="true" accessors="true" 
      visibility="true">      
      <attributes public="true" package="true" protected="true" private="true" static="true"/>      
      <operations public="true" package="true" protected="true" private="true" static="true"/>    
    </display>  
  </class>  
  <class id="3" language="java" name="net.timbusproject.dpes.data.CostRule" project="dpesWebapp" 
    file="/dpesWebapp/src/main/java/net/timbusproject/dpes/data/CostRule.java" binary="false" corner="BOTTOM_RIGHT">    
    <position height="-1" width="-1" x="474" y="287"/>    
    <display autosize="true" stereotype="true" package="true" initial-value="false" signature="true" accessors="true" 
      visibility="true">      
      <attributes public="true" package="true" protected="true" private="true" static="true"/>      
      <operations public="true" package="true" protected="true" private="true" static="true"/>    
    </display>  
  </class>  
  <class id="4" language="java" name="net.timbusproject.dpes.data.Artifact" project="dpesWebapp" 
    file="/dpesWebapp/src/main/java/net/timbusproject/dpes/data/Artifact.java" binary="false" corner="BOTTOM_RIGHT">    
    <position height="-1" width="-1" x="956" y="-366"/>    
    <display autosize="true" stereotype="true" package="true" initial-value="false" signature="true" accessors="true" 
      visibility="true">      
      <attributes public="true" package="true" protected="true" private="true" static="true"/>      
      <operations public="true" package="true" protected="true" private="true" static="true"/>    
    </display>  
  </class>  
  <class id="5" language="java" name="net.timbusproject.dpes.data.Resource" project="dpesWebapp" 
    file="/dpesWebapp/src/main/java/net/timbusproject/dpes/data/Resource.java" binary="false" corner="BOTTOM_RIGHT">    
    <position height="-1" width="-1" x="1063" y="340"/>    
    <display autosize="true" stereotype="true" package="true" initial-value="false" signature="true" accessors="true" 
      visibility="true">      
      <attributes public="true" package="true" protected="true" private="true" static="true"/>      
      <operations public="true" package="true" protected="true" private="true" static="true"/>    
    </display>  
  </class>  
  <interface id="6" language="java" name="net.timbusproject.dpes.api.ICostRule" project="dpesWebapp" 
    file="/dpesWebapp/src/main/java/net/timbusproject/dpes/api/ICostRule.java" binary="false" corner="BOTTOM_RIGHT">    
    <position height="-1" width="-1" x="747" y="278"/>    
    <display autosize="true" stereotype="true" package="true" initial-value="false" signature="true" accessors="true" 
      visibility="true">      
      <attributes public="true" package="true" protected="true" private="true" static="true"/>      
      <operations public="true" package="true" protected="true" private="true" static="true"/>    
    </display>  
  </interface>  
  <interface id="7" language="java" name="net.timbusproject.dpes.api.IResource" project="dpesWebapp" 
    file="/dpesWebapp/src/main/java/net/timbusproject/dpes/api/IResource.java" binary="false" corner="BOTTOM_RIGHT">    
    <position height="-1" width="-1" x="1403" y="346"/>    
    <display autosize="true" stereotype="true" package="true" initial-value="false" signature="true" accessors="true" 
      visibility="true">      
      <attributes public="true" package="true" protected="true" private="true" static="true"/>      
      <operations public="true" package="true" protected="true" private="true" static="true"/>    
    </display>  
  </interface>  
  <interface id="8" language="java" name="net.timbusproject.dpes.api.IArtifact" project="dpesWebapp" 
    file="/dpesWebapp/src/main/java/net/timbusproject/dpes/api/IArtifact.java" binary="false" corner="BOTTOM_RIGHT">    
    <position height="-1" width="-1" x="1233" y="-362"/>    
    <display autosize="true" stereotype="true" package="true" initial-value="false" signature="true" accessors="true" 
      visibility="true">      
      <attributes public="true" package="true" protected="true" private="true" static="true"/>      
      <operations public="true" package="true" protected="true" private="true" static="true"/>    
    </display>  
  </interface>  
  <interface id="9" language="java" name="net.timbusproject.dpes.api.IBusinessProcess" project="dpesWebapp" 
    file="/dpesWebapp/src/main/java/net/timbusproject/dpes/api/IBusinessProcess.java" binary="false" 
    corner="BOTTOM_RIGHT">    
    <position height="496" width="221" x="174" y="-735"/>    
    <display autosize="true" stereotype="true" package="true" initial-value="false" signature="true" accessors="true" 
      visibility="true">      
      <attributes public="true" package="true" protected="true" private="true" static="true"/>      
      <operations public="true" package="true" protected="true" private="true" static="true"/>    
    </display>  
  </interface>  
  <interface id="10" language="java" name="net.timbusproject.dpes.api.ICosting" project="dpesWebapp" 
    file="/dpesWebapp/src/main/java/net/timbusproject/dpes/api/ICosting.java" binary="false" corner="BOTTOM_RIGHT">    
    <position height="-1" width="-1" x="127" y="131"/>    
    <display autosize="true" stereotype="true" package="true" initial-value="false" signature="true" accessors="true" 
      visibility="true">      
      <attributes public="true" package="true" protected="true" private="true" static="true"/>      
      <operations public="true" package="true" protected="true" private="true" static="true"/>    
    </display>  
  </interface>  
  <association id="11">    
    <end type="SOURCE" refId="2" navigable="false">      
      <attribute id="12" name="artifacts"/>      
      <multiplicity id="13" minimum="0" maximum="2147483647"/>    
    </end>    
    <end type="TARGET" refId="4" navigable="true"/>    
    <display labels="true" multiplicity="true"/>  
  </association>  
  <realization id="14">    
    <end type="SOURCE" refId="5"/>    
    <end type="TARGET" refId="7"/>  
  </realization>  
  <association id="15">    
    <end type="SOURCE" refId="2" navigable="false">      
      <attribute id="16" name="resources"/>      
      <multiplicity id="17" minimum="0" maximum="2147483647"/>    
    </end>    
    <end type="TARGET" refId="5" navigable="true"/>    
    <display labels="true" multiplicity="true"/>  
  </association>  
  <realization id="18">    
    <end type="SOURCE" refId="2"/>    
    <end type="TARGET" refId="9"/>  
  </realization>  
  <association id="19">    
    <end type="SOURCE" refId="1" navigable="false">      
      <attribute id="20" name="bp"/>      
      <multiplicity id="21" minimum="0" maximum="1"/>    
    </end>    
    <end type="TARGET" refId="2" navigable="true"/>    
    <display labels="true" multiplicity="true"/>  
  </association>  
  <realization id="22">    
    <end type="SOURCE" refId="1"/>    
    <end type="TARGET" refId="10"/>  
  </realization>  
  <association id="23">    
    <end type="SOURCE" refId="1" navigable="false">      
      <attribute id="24" name="costRules"/>      
      <multiplicity id="25" minimum="0" maximum="2147483647"/>    
    </end>    
    <end type="TARGET" refId="3" navigable="true"/>    
    <display labels="true" multiplicity="true"/>  
  </association>  
  <realization id="26">    
    <end type="SOURCE" refId="4"/>    
    <end type="TARGET" refId="8"/>  
  </realization>  
  <realization id="27">    
    <end type="SOURCE" refId="3"/>    
    <end type="TARGET" refId="6"/>  
  </realization>  
  <classifier-display autosize="true" stereotype="true" package="true" initial-value="false" signature="true" 
    accessors="true" visibility="true">    
    <attributes public="true" package="true" protected="true" private="true" static="true"/>    
    <operations public="true" package="true" protected="true" private="true" static="true"/>  
  </classifier-display>  
  <association-display labels="true" multiplicity="true"/>
</class-diagram>